WebApr 7, 2024 · The Evidence Supporting a Link Between Autism and Gut Health Gastrointestinal difficulties and poor gut health are a common complaint among autistic individuals. According to a 2003 study of 137 autistic children, 24 percent experienced chronic gastrointestinal problems, most commonly diarrhea and constipation. WebApr 7, 2015 · One study, published in 2013, found that children with autism are six to eight times more likely to have gastrointestinal problems than those without autism. WebDefecatory dyssynergia (Anismus) is a type of pelvic floor dysfunction that makes it difficult to produce a bowel movement. The condition occurs when the muscles of the pelvic floor are unable to coordinate with the surrounding muscles and nerves. This condition can sometimes lead to chronic constipation.
